Abstract

The utility model provides an electric connector, which is used for matching with an extension card. The utility model comprises an insulation body, a conducting terminal contained in the insulation body and a locking device of which at least one end is positioned in the insulation body and can rotate around the insulation body, wherein the locking device is a bent metal rod. The electric connector of the utility model has the advantages of easy installation and stable buckling state, and can ensure good electric conduction.

Description

Electric connector
[technical field]
The utility model relates to a kind of electric connector, especially a kind of electric connector of buckle device with lock.
[background technology]
Expansion board is a kind of circuit board arrangement, promptly is provided with the electronic component that can produce above-mentioned corresponding function on circuit board, constitutes by circuit relative on a connector and the motherboard to electrically connect.Usually, connector is when connecting expansion board, need locker to locate, prior art please refer to No. 5494451, United States Patent (USP) US, this patent disclosure a kind of buckling structure of printed circuit board (PCB), the printed circuit board (PCB) that is used for inserting connector places settling position, above-mentioned device for fastening comprises the connector fixed part that is used for clamping connector, and be attached thereto the plate end fixed part that connects, the connector fixed part is connected by elastic joint part with plate end fixed part, in addition, above-mentioned plate end fixed part is connected with protuberance, and it can make printed circuit board (PCB) disengaging plate end fixed part.Yet this structure need be pulled in the fastening process repeatedly, easily causes permanent deformation, and this kind buckling structure button to hold power too little, occur looseningly easily, cause the loose contact with expansion board, influence its normal electric connection.
Therefore, be necessary to design a kind of novel electric connector, to overcome above-mentioned defective.
[summary of the invention]
The utility model purpose is to provide a kind of novel electric connector, and its button keeps steady fixed, can guarantee well to electrically conduct.
For achieving the above object, the utility model electric connector, in order to match with expansion board, the locker that it comprises insulating body, is contained in the conducting terminal in this insulating body and is positioned at least one end of insulating body and can rotate around insulating body, and this locker is the Metallic rod through bending.
Compared with prior art, it is easy for installation for the utility model electric connector, and button keeps steady fixed, can guarantee well to electrically conduct.

[embodiment]
Below in conjunction with the drawings and specific embodiments the utility model electric connector is described further.
See also Fig. 1 to Fig. 6, the utility model electric connector is in order to match the locker 3 that it comprises insulating body 1, is contained in the conducting terminal 2 in this insulating body 1 and is positioned at insulating body 1 end 10 with expansion board 4.
It is microscler that insulating body 1 slightly is, and the centre position is provided with a slot 11 of accommodating expansion board 4, and slot 11 both sides are provided with some terminal accommodation holes 12 of accommodating terminal, and this slot 11 forms with this accepting hole 12 and is communicated with, and is provided with conducting terminal 2 in the terminal accommodation holes 12.Be provided with in insulating body 1 end 10 in order to the axis hole 13 that articulates this locker and this locker of guiding guiding structural to axis hole 13, this guiding structural comprises by bottom surface, end make progress a diminishing guide channel 14 of size and a guiding block 15, this guiding block is that the projection that is wedge shape is (certain, also guide channel or guiding block can only be set, also can reach the effect of guiding), wherein guide channel 14 can be directed to correct position in the horizontal direction with locker 3, and guiding block 15 can be directed to correct position with locker 3 in the vertical directions.Also be provided with in order to locate the location structure (in present embodiment this location structure be groove 16 that in the vertical direction connect) of this locker in the insulating body end at closure state.In addition, also be provided with in 10 outsides, insulating body end in order to limit the block 17 that this locker outwards excessively rotates.When this electric connector was mounted on the circuit board, being provided with between these 10 lower ends, insulating body end and the circuit board (not icon) can be for the gap of locker 3 insertions, with convenient this locker of installing.
This locker 3 is the Metallic rod through bending, comprise base portion 30, be located at base portion 30 1 ends buckling parts 31, be located at the articulated section 32 of the base portion 30 relative other ends in order to match with axis hole 13, base portion 30 is two bodies of rod that vertically are provided with, articulated section 32 is formed by the terminal inwardly horizontal-extending of the body of rod, buckling parts 31 connects a wherein body of rod and horizontal setting, and this locker 3 also further comprises an operating portion 33, these operating portion 33 1 ends connect buckling parts 31, the other end then links to each other with another body of rod, by pulling this operating portion 33 locker is rotated between open mode and closure state.
Certainly, the shape of described locker 3 ' also can be set to the body of rod of base portion 30 ' for vertically being provided with, articulated section 32 ' is formed by the extension of body of rod terminal horizontal, buckling parts 31 ' forms for body of rod other end horizontal-extending, wherein 32 ' end is provided with a flexible member 34 ' in addition in the articulated section, and can fix by a fixture 35 ' when described locker 3 ' is installed on the body, at this moment, this body of rod and flexible member 34 ' lay respectively at the both sides (as shown in Figure 7) of body.
When expansion board 4 is installed, elder generation's rotation locking device 3 makes it be in open mode, insert expansion board 4, make locker 3 be in closure state again, at this moment, the buckling parts 31 of locker matches with the holding section 40 on the expansion board 4, make firm being connected on this electric connector of expansion board, when taking out expansion board, only need make locker be in open mode, just can take out expansion board.In addition, this locker 3 also can inwardly be pulled to level, is beneficial to packing.
